Steps for Conducting a Mechanical Equipment Assessment
Conducting a thorough mechanical equipment assessment involves several key steps to ensure a comprehensive evaluation of machinery. The first step is to gather all relevant documentation, including equipment manuals, maintenance records, and safety guidelines. This provides valuable insight into the history and condition of the machinery, as well as any specific requirements for assessment. The next step is to visually inspect the equipment for any signs of wear, damage, or potential safety hazards. This includes checking for loose or damaged components, leaks, and any abnormal sounds or vibrations during operation.
Following the visual inspection, it is important to conduct performance tests to assess the functionality and efficiency of the machinery. This can include testing for proper alignment, lubrication, and overall performance under normal operating conditions. Additionally, it is essential to review the training and competency of personnel operating the equipment to ensure they are properly trained and qualified. Finally, it is crucial to document all findings and develop a plan for addressing any identified issues. By following these steps, companies can conduct a thorough mechanical equipment assessment to ensure the safety and efficiency of their machinery.

Utilizing Technology for Monitoring and Maintenance
Technology plays a crucial role in monitoring and maintaining mechanical equipment to ensure ongoing safety and efficiency. There are various tools and systems available that can help companies track the performance and condition of their machinery in real-time. This includes sensors that monitor temperature, vibration, and other key indicators of machinery health. Additionally, there are software programs that can help companies schedule and track maintenance tasks to ensure that equipment is properly maintained.
Furthermore, technology can help companies identify potential issues with machinery before they escalate into costly breakdowns or safety hazards. By utilizing predictive maintenance tools, companies can proactively address any potential issues before they impact operations. Additionally, technology can help companies optimize the performance of their machinery by providing valuable data on energy consumption, production output, and overall efficiency. In essence, utilizing technology for monitoring and maintenance is essential for ensuring the ongoing safety and efficiency of mechanical equipment.
